Katrin Komarova Email
Head IT Sales . SeaRates
Edinburgh,
LocationPrimary Email
How to contact Katrin Komarova
Join and see Katrin's contact info for free!Current Roles
Employees:
83Revenue:
$25.3MAbout
SeaRates Address
17000 Jebal aliEdinburgh, null
UK